Congratulations go to Lizzie Watson (Class of 2018) who has been randomly selected as our Easter Princethorpe Connect Prize Draw winner. A host of chocolate treats are now winging their way to her in time for the Easter weekend.
We touched base with Lizzie to let her know of her win and this is what she had to say.
“I am absolutely delighted to have won the Easter hamper and can’t thank Princethorpe enough! After finishing Sixth Form in 2018, I went on to study Automotive and Transport Design at Coventry University where I achieved a 2:1 and graduated in May 2021.
Within three weeks of finishing my degree I packed my bags and moved to London to start a job at Savills Head Office within the client services team. I have been in the role almost a year, creating relationships with clients and colleagues while dealing with the craziness of the property market - which hasn’t stopped!
Having built up my LinkedIn network, I was recently offered a new role within Savills as a Prime Sales Assistant within the St John’s Wood Team, which I start on Monday 11 April. I look forward to keeping in touch with all those at Princethorpe.“
We now know who to contact when we need a new home in London and wish Lizzie all the very best with her new role!
